“…Electro migration was used to recover 99.9% tin with a lead cathode, a tin anode and hydrogen chloride electrolyte (Gergo et al 2012). A laboratory experiment which used a tin anode, an iron cathode and hydrogen chloride electrolyte yielded a low 9% recovery (Jumari et al 2018). The type of electrodes has a significant bearing on the amount of material recovered.…”

“…Metal extraction by electro migration is a two-stage process which begins with dissolution where the tailings are dissolved in a preheated acid or base solution (Jumari et al 2018). The solution is then agitated at a predetermined speed to ensure complete dissolution.…”
